Abstract
A series of compounds structurally relate to 4'-[(2, 3, 4, 5-tetrahydro-1H-1-benzazepin-1-yl) carbonyl] benzanilide was synthesized and demonstrated to have arginine vasopressin (AVP) antagonist activity for both V 1A and V 2 receptors. The introduction of a phenyl or a 4- substituted phenyl group into the ortho position of the benzoyl moiety resulted in an increase in both binding affinity and antagonistic activity.
